Bid for 900-plus Over 55s senior housing project in NSW's Hunter Valley
The additional 913 housing for Over 55s in Maitland.
Key points

Maitland seniors housing project eyes 900-home expansion

  • Major scale-up: Developers plan 913 more homes at Berry Park
  • Community living: New wellness hubs, pool and open spaces proposed
  • Connected model: Expanded shuttle service to support ageing in place
  • SSD pathway: Rezoning sought to unlock large seniors housing precinct

Berry Park Village and its neighbouring development, Berry Park Gatehouse, have been operating in the city of Maitland since 2020. 

The venture, by Kevin Eacott and Hilton Grugeon AM, has Berry Park Village, with 162 homes, and Berry Park Gatehouse, with 94 dwellings. Across both sites is a network of community facilities to support residents including outdoor areas, community halls, wellness centre, outdoor recreation areas and men’s shed.

The completed Berry Park Village in Maitland.

Now the property developers want to add an additional 913 dwellings in the form of seniors housing, targeting people aged 55 years and over, on the site.

Berry Park Village and the Gatehouse currently enjoy access to “facilities and services” away from the site through an on-call, 24/7 shuttle bus service which has provision for access by people with a disability. This service is to be expanded as part of the project.

Hilton Grugeon AM.

The project is a State Significant Development (SSD) for the construction of up to 913 dwellings with a 2% allocation of affordable housing.

Development consent is sought for:

  • Construction of 913 seniors dwellings;
  • Construction of community centres, indoor pool and medical room;
  • Open space facilities including Central Park; and
  • Construction of internal accessways (private streets) linking the new development to the existing seniors housing development and construction of internal driveways to public roads.

A concurrent rezoning proposal will amend the Maitland Local Environment Plan 2011 to permit seniors housing as an additional permissible use on the site.
